Key finding
Oral THC led to adequate pain relief in only a portion of patients, while the majority did not respond sufficiently.
Summary
Open-label study (n=13) of oral delta-9-THC in chronic non-malignant pain (CNMP) without response to standard therapy; 5 of 13 patients (38%) reported adequate response, 8 of 13 (62%) inadequate or no response; 6 patients with adverse events, 2 study discontinuations. Oral THC therapy in selected therapy-refractory CNMP patients possibly an option.

Abstract
Cannabinoids have been used for pain relief for centuries and recent studies have investigated their analgesic and anti-inflammatory mechanisms, as well as clinical efficacy, in treating chronic pain. We report an open-label study addressed to evaluate the effect and adverse events of orally administered Delta-9-tetrahydrocannabinol (Delta-9-THC) in 13 patients with chronic nonmalignant pain (CNMP) unresponsive to conventional pharmacotherapy. The effect of the treatment was assessed on an eight-item HRQoL questionnaire. Five out of 13 patients reported adequate response to the treatment while eight patients reported inadequate or no response. Seven patients did not experience any adverse events (AEs), six patients reported AEs, two of which discontinued the treatment. We conclude that oral THC may be a valuable therapeutic option for selected patients with CNMP that are unresponsive to previous treatments, though further research is warranted to characterize those patients.
